Setting Alerts Add an Alert: 1. Click on the title at the top of the web part to view the menu Example: Announcements 2. Click Actions drop down arrow and select Alert Me to receive e-mail notifications when items change This menu can be set using any web part by going to the Actions drop down arrow 3. Alert Title and Send Alerts To are already filled in The default setting for Change Type is All Changes. Most used is New Items Added. Descriptions: All Changes = Email is sent for every edit, addition, and change to the Announcement web part New Items Added Email is sent for only when New items are added Existing Items are Modified Email is sent for all changes to already saved announcements Items are Deleted You will receive e-mail only when items are deleted Department of Technology Services - Revised 1/27/2010 kt Page 4 of 19

4. Change Type, click New Items are Added for an email to be sent only when new items are added to Announcements. 5. Send Alerts for These Changes, click An announcement with an expiration date that is added or changed to receive an email only when an announcement is expired or modified. 6. When to Send Alerts, click Send a Daily Summary for an email daily with a summary of all the changes selected above in the alert options. 7. Optional: Select the Time of day you want the alerts to be sent to your email box. 8. Click OK An email will be sent to your email confirming the alert is setup right after you click OK. Document Library Microsoft SharePoint 2007 Add a Document to a Library: 1. Select the Document link in the left navigation bar to see all libraries or select the specific library from the left navigation bar if it displays 2. Select Upload, Upload Document for a single document Multiple documents can be uploaded using the Upload multiple Documents link for advanced users. If versioning is turned on there will be an additional section to add Version Comments as to what was changed. You will also have a link below the Browse button allowing you to Upload Multiple Files. 3. Click the Browse button to open for this example 4. Locate the file using the Choose File to Upload window, click on the file to highlight, then click Open Department of Technology Services - Revised 1/27/2010 kt Page 9 of 19

5. The path to the file is automatically entered for you, click OK The Overwrite existing file is checked and the file will be replaced unless this box is unchecked. The file is uploaded to the specific library with!new next to the file title. If the file was replaced there would not be a symbol next to the title. Modify Documents Using Check Out: 1. Click the drop down arrow to display the menu options and select Check Out. Microsoft Internet Explorer window will display only once. Uncheck the Use my local drafts folder and click OK. The document will be saved back to SharePoint. 2. The file will display default information, Date and Modified by Department of Technology Services - Revised 1/27/2010 kt Page 10 of 19

3. Locate the file and click the drop down arrow, then select Edit in Microsoft Word. Edit menu will change according to the file type. When the icon displays a green arrow pointing down, the file is Checked Out. 4. In the security Message from webpage, click OK 5. Type dpsuser\ your Login Name and Password, then click OK 6. Make changes to the document, close the window using the red X. 7. Click Yes to save the changes to the document. The document will be saved back to the SharePoint library. Department of Technology Services - Revised 1/27/2010 kt Page 11 of 19

8. When asked in the program window of Word, click Yes to Check In, so changes can be viewed by users. You will be returned to the Document Library and your changes can be viewed by staff with access. Check IN: 1. If you saved without Check-In you will need to select Check-In from the menu on the document before anyone will see your changes. 2. Type Comments about the changes made 3. Click OK to continue to Check-In. The file will be updated and available for the next review. Organization of Files Create Folders: 1.
